Just Fontaine was born on August 14, 1933, in Marrakesh, Morocco. He grew up in French-controlled Morocco, raised by his French father and Spanish mother. It was in Marrakesh that he developed a passion for football and began honing his skills on the local pitches.
Fontaine started his professional career with the local team USM Marrakesh in 1950. His talent caught the attention of scouts, and he soon made the move to France to pursue a career in professional football. He went on to play for three clubs during his career, but it was at Stade Reims where he truly made a name for himself.
Fontaine joined Stade Reims in 1956 and quickly became a standout player for the team. Over the course of six seasons, he scored an impressive 122 goals for the club. His scoring prowess helped lead Stade Reims to multiple victories and solidified his reputation as one of the best strikers of his generation.
Fontaine's greatest moment came during the 1958 World Cup, where he made history by scoring an incredible 13 goals in the tournament. His goal-scoring heroics propelled France to the semi-finals, solidifying his legacy as one of the greatest goal scorers in World Cup history.
Throughout his career, Fontaine also represented the French national team, scoring a total of 30 goals in 21 appearances between 1953 and 1960. He formed a dynamic partnership with fellow French football legend Raymond Kopa, and together they led France to numerous victories on the international stage.
